I-K8076 iyikhithi yokuhlanganisa enamaphuzu angama-202. Yenzelwe abaqalayo abanezinga lobunzima le-1-3, kodwa futhi ifanele abasebenzisi abathuthukile. Idivayisi ithobelana neNgxenye 15 yeMithetho ye-FCC, inqobo nje uma imiyalelo efakiwe ilandelwa.
I-K8076 ifaka isokhethi ye-ZIF yephinikhodi engu-40 elungisekayo, evumela ukukhetha okulula kwe-microcontroller kusetshenziswa ama-patch jumpers. Iza nesofthiwe ye-PICprog2006TM yokuhlela futhi ihlanganisa isethi yezixhumi ze-SUBD. Isidingo sokuhlinzekwa kwamandla yi-15V DC enobuncane be-300mA, futhi ingaxhunywa kusetshenziswa i-adaptha ye-PS1508. Ubukhulu bedivayisi buyi-132x65x20mm. Izilawuli ezisekelwayo okwamanje yi-PIC10F200, PIC12C508A, PIC12CE518, PIC12F629, PIC12F675, PIC16F54, PIC16F84A, PIC16F870, PIC16F871, PIC16F872IC16F, PIC873F 16, PIC874F16, PIC876F16, PIC877F16A, PIC627F16, PIC627F16A, PIC628F16A, PIC628F16, PIC648F16, kanye ne-PIC630F16.
Izidingo eziyisisekelo zesistimu zokusebenzisa i-K8076 i-PC Evumelana ne-IBM ene-Pentium noma iphrosesa engcono kanye nesistimu yokusebenza ye-Windows 98/ME/NT/2000/XP. Idrayivu ye-CDROM kanye nembobo ye-REAL serial (RS232) yamahhala nayo iyadingeka. Sicela uqaphele ukuthi ukusebenza kwekhadi lomhleli we-PIC akunakuqinisekiswa ngekhebula lokuguqula le-USB.

Izici & Imininingwane
Izici
- onboard okulungisekayo 40 pin. I-ZIF isokhethi
- Ukukhetha i-Microcontroller usebenzisa i-patch jumper
- kulula ukuyisebenzisa isofthiwe ye-PICprog2006TM efakiwe ? Isethi yesixhumi se-SUBD ifakiwe
Imininingwane
- Ukunikezwa kwamandla: 15V DC, min. I-adaptha engu-300mA (Ex. PS1508)
- isixhumi sembobo se-serial: 9 p. I-SUBD
- ubukhulu: 132x65x20mm / 5,23 x 2,57 x 0,79″
- izilawuli ezisekelwayo njengamanje (rev. 2.0.0.0) :
- I-PIC10F200
- I-PIC12C508A,PIC12CE518
- I-PIC12F629,PIC12F675
- I-PIC16F54
- I-PIC16F84A
- PIC16F870,PIC16F871,PIC16F872,PIC16F873*,PIC16F874*
- I-PIC16F876,PIC16F877*
- PIC16F627,PIC16F627A,PIC16F628,PIC16F628A
- PIC16F648A* PIC16F630,PIC16F676
- I-PIC18F2550,...
- (*): ngaphansi kokuhlolwa
Ubuncane bezidingo zesistimu
- I-PC ehambisanayo ye-IBM, iPentium noma engcono
- Amawindi? 98/ME/NT/2000/XP
- Idrayivu ye-CDROM
- Imbobo yamahhala ye-REAL serial (RS232) iyadingeka*
(*) Ukusebenza kwekhadi lomhleli we-PIC akukwazi ukuqinisekiswa ngekhebula lokuguqula le-USB.

Kulungile, ngakho siyakunaka. Lawa macebiso azokusiza ukuthi wenze lo msebenzi uphumelele. Zifunde ngokucophelela.
Qiniseka ukuthi unamathuluzi alungile
- Insimbi yekhwalithi enhle (25-40W) enethiphu elincane.
- Sula kaningi ngesipontshi esimanzi noma indwangu, ukuze uyigcine ihlanzekile; bese usebenzisa i-solder ku-tip, ukuze unikeze ukubukeka okumanzi. Lokhu kubizwa ngokuthi 'ukunciphisa' futhi kuzovikela ithiphu, futhi kukuvumela ukuthi wenze ukuxhumana okuhle. Lapho i-solder iphuma ithiphu, idinga ukuhlanzwa.
- I-solder encane ye-raisin-core. Ungasebenzisi noma iyiphi i-flux noma igrisi.
- I-diagonal cutter yokusika izintambo eziningi. Ukuze ugweme ukulimala lapho usika umkhondo oweqile, bamba umthofu ukuze ungeke undizele ubheke emehlweni.
- Amapayipi ekhala yenaliti, okugoba umkhondo, noma ukubamba izingxenye endaweni.
- I-blade encane kanye ne-screwdrivers ye-Phillips. Ububanzi obuyisisekelo bulungile.
Kwamanye amaphrojekthi, isisekelo samamitha amaningi siyadingeka, noma singase sibe usizo

Faka isixhumi se-SUBD ezinhlangothini zombili zekhebula elivikelwe elingu-6-core. Bheka emkhiwaneni. 2.0 ngezansi.
Uma ungazihlanganisi izintambo nezixhumi ze-SUBD ezifakiwe, naka lokhu okulandelayo: wonke amakhondakta kufanele axhumeke “I-PIN ku-PIN”.Manje, faka indawo ebiyelwe phezu kwesixhumi ngasinye se-SUBD ngokusho komkhiwane. 3.0
- I-PIC – ikhebula lokukhetha
- Sika ucezu lwentambo ngayinye yesixhumi sowesifazane 'sebhodi-kuya-entambo' ukuze kube no-6cm wocingo olusele kusixhumi. Bheka umkhiwane. 4.0
- Sika izingcezu ezi-5 zeshubhu elishwabene ngobude obulingana no-1cm.
- Shelelezisa ishubhu elishwabene phezu kwezintambo zesixhumi 'sebhodi ukuya kucingo' lesifazane (umkhiwane 5.0)
- Soda ucingo ngalunye kutheminali yensimbi
- Qaphela: Ngaso sonke isikhathi qiniseka ukuthi ushelela phansi kweshubhu elinciphayo kude ngokwanele ukusuka ezindaweni zokunamathisela!
- Shelelisela ishubhu elishwabene phezu kwamalunga athengiswe bese uwashisisa usebenzisa isomisi sezinwele noma, okungcono nakakhulu, usebenzisa upende.
